Request to rezone property from General Retail to Heavy Commercial to create uniform zoning across the parcel.
Denied due to significant resident opposition citing concerns about increased traffic, noise, and potential for incompatible commercial uses in a mixed-use area.

A request to change zoning from multi-family to single-family housing in a neighborhood along E. Fleming Street and Kenwood Lane was considered. This aims to facilitate new single-family home construction and ensure lot compliance.
